Where is the Newsborn family from?

You can see how Newsborn families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Newsborn family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1891 and 1920. The most Newsborn families were found in USA in 1920, and United Kingdom in 1891. In 1891 there was 1 Newsborn family living in Yorkshire. This was 100% of all the recorded Newsborn's in United Kingdom. Yorkshire had the highest population of Newsborn families in 1891.
